Transaction 62a91cd040cea32e29cf9b99fb6f5fdcd0d1c58edaec8afe6f991a3480f6837b
1 Input
1 Output
-
62a91cd040cea32e29cf9b99fb6f5fdcd0d1c58edaec8afe6f991a3480f6837b:0
- value
- 937248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ad128701d820cdbe535e461ef26c9f6361b088e6 OP_EQUAL
- address
- 3HU922yGJoxehbsr4uwwMxhpzZN4A2rAtW